Client Profile Preview - Whats included and excluded


My understanding of the client profile preview is that it's a stripped down version of .NET focusing on fulfiling the needs of client applications.

However it would be useful to know what is included and excluded from this? Does anyone know?


Solution

  • Here is a list of included assemblies from BCL Team Blog @ MSDN:

    BCL, "Core FX," and LINQ

    * CustomMarshalers
    * ISymWrapper
    * mscorlib
    * sysglobl
    * System
    * System.AddIn
    * System.AddIn.Contract
    * System.Configuration
    * System.Configuration.Install
    * System.Core
    * System.Security
    

    Visual Basic and Visual C++ Language Support

    * Microsoft.VisualBasic
    * Microsoft.VisualC
    

    XML

    * System.Xml
    * System.Xml.Linq
    

    Windows Forms

    * Accessibility
    * System.Drawing
    * System.Windows.Forms
    

    WPF

    * PresentationCore
    * PresentationFramework
    * PresentationFramework.Aero
    * PresentationFramework.Classic
    * PresentationFramework.Luna
    * PresentationFramework.Royale
    * PresentationUI
    * ReachFramework
    * System.Printing
    * System.Windows.Presentation
    * UIAutomationClient
    * UIAutomationClientsideProviders
    * UIAutomationProvider
    * UIAutomationTypes
    * WindowsBase
    * WindowsFormsIntegration
    

    ClickOnce

    * System.Deployment
    

    WCF, Web Services, Remoting, and Serialization

    * System.IdentityModel
    * System.Runtime.Remoting
    * System.Runtime.Serialization
    * System.Runtime.Serialization.Formatters.Soap
    * System.ServiceModel
    * System.ServiceModel.Web
    * System.ServiceModel.Install
    * System.Transactions
    * System.Web.Services
    

    Data Access

    * System.Data
    * System.Data.SqlXml
    * System.Data.DataSetExtensions
    * System.Data.Services.Client
    

    Peer to Peer

    * System.Net
    

    Active Directory and Enterprise Services

    * System.DirectoryServices
    * System.EnterpriseServices
